Alpacas from Eighth and Mud is a labour of love by husband and wife John and Sharon. During your visit, tour the historical barn, visit the gift shop and, of course, interact with the alpacas. See how alpaca fibre is used by spinners, weavers and knitters, and learn how this farm has evolved over 200 years from grapes to alpacas.
Architecture
Year built: Main barn c. 1820; addition in 1915; north barn 2012Building type:Commercial
